Description
Interleukin 35 (IL-35) is a recently discovered anti-inflammatory cytokine from the IL-12 family. Member of IL-12 family - IL-35 is produced by wide range of regulatory lymphocytes and plays a role in immune suppression. IL-35 can block the development of Th1 and Th17 cells by limiting early T cell proliferation. The heterodimeric cytokine of IL-35 involves two subunits of p35 and Ebi3 which are also seen in IL-12 and IL-27. IL-35 is recognized as a defi nite immunosuppressor with a huge potent of suppression.
